Air America now in Lafayette

Lafayette has become the third Louisiana city to have an Air America affiliate. Cajun Communications flipped 1490/KEUN from simulcasting 105.5/KEUN's ABC Real Country format this morning, with Morning Sedition as the first program aired.

From what I've heard, the signal covers Lafayette fairly well, with the exception of a couple of spots where another, yet-to-be-identified station comes through at 1480, causing some interference.

Re: Air America in Lafayette for now!

This was part of AM Auction 84. KEUN was a singleton
in the auction and is therefore allowed to file. They've
made a few amendments otherwise this would have been done
long ago. Moving an AM (even if it's the only one in a COL)
has become pretty common. The FCC looks at the number of
people that will be served. The case here is that Pineville
has no service. We all know it does but under the FCC it does
not so this is allowed. There are a bunch of these that are
about to happen in Louisiana. The KEUN move is a rubber stamp
at this point. That was the point of the auction.

If the new rules get put into place, expect a flurry of these
to start especially on the AM band.
